What is Instant Polenta?

Do you people understand what polenta is? No! Polenta is a typical Italian dish prepared from crushed cornmeal, water, and salt, and don’t worry guys, here is the solution to all of your questions.

It has long been a mainstay in Italian cooking and is frequently served as a side dish or the foundation for other meals. In contrast, instant polenta is a pre-cooked kind of polenta that has undergone processing to shorten the cooking process.

Manufacturers partially cook and dry the cornmeal before packaging it for sale. This process creates polenta, which time-pressed home cooks favor because it can be made in a matter of minutes.

How to Cook Instant Polenta

Cooking your polenta is a breeze. Here’s how to do it.

Ingredients to Make Instant Polenta

  • 1 cup of quick polenta
  • 4 cups of broth or water
  • 1 teaspoon of salt

Instructions to Make Instant Polenta

  • In a large saucepan, simmer the water or broth to a boil
  • Add the salt
  • Stir continuously as you gradually mix in the instant polenta
  • Reduce the heat to low and keep stirring the polenta for about 5-10 mins until it begins to thicken
  • Serve immediately after removing from the heat

Variations and Serving Suggestions for Instant Polenta

Polenta is highly adaptable since you may alter it to suit your tastes. Listed below are a few other options.

Add Cheese

Stir in grated Parmesan or cheddar cheese for added flavor.

Use Broth Instead of Water

For even more flavor, use chicken or vegetable broth instead of water.

Add Herbs

Stir in fresh or dried herbs, such as basil or oregano, for a burst of flavor.

Make it Creamy

Add a splash of cream or milk to the polenta before serving for a creamier texture.

As for serving suggestions, here are a few ideas.

  • Serve alongside fish or poultry that has been cooked
  • Use as a foundation for a vegetarian dish that includes tomato sauce and roasted veggies
  • For a filling vegetarian supper, serve with sauteed mushrooms and onions
  • Making polenta fries involves chilling cooked polenta until solid, slicing it into fries, then frying them in heated oil until golden

FAQsInstant Polenta

Does quick polenta contain no gluten?

As cornmeal is inherently gluten-free, most quick polenta is also gluten-free. But, if you have a gluten sensitivity or allergy, it’s crucial to read the label because certain products could be made in facilities that also process wheat, barley, or rye.

How long does instant polenta last?

Instant polenta has a long shelf life and can be stored in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 6 months. Once cooked, it can be refrigerated for up to 3 days, or frozen for up to 3 months.
